Common Reasons Why Your Vuse Isn’t Working

When your Vuse vape malfunctions, it can often be attributed to a few common culprits. Here are some potential reasons why your device may not be working:

1. Battery Issues

The battery is the lifeblood of your Vuse vape. If you’re experiencing a lack of vapor or your device isn’t turning on, your issues may stem from the battery.

Battery Not Charged

One of the simplest explanations is that the battery is dead. Ensure you’re charging your Vuse device adequately. The charging duration can differ based on the battery type, but typically, it takes a couple of hours for a full charge.

Faulty Charging Equipment

Sometimes, the problem lies not with your battery but with the charger. Inspect the charging cable and port for any visible signs of damage. If you notice any cracks or frays, it may be time to replace them.

2. Cartridge Problems

If the battery is functional but vapor production still persists, examine the cartridge.

Empty Cartridge

Have you recently refilled or replaced your cartridge? An empty cartridge is an obvious culprit. Always check to ensure there is e-liquid in the cartridge before attempting to use your device.

Clogged Coil

Over time, the heating element can become clogged with residue. This build-up can prevent the e-liquid from being vaporized efficiently. To fix this, consider cleaning the coil or replacing it altogether if needed.

3. Device Not Turning On

If your Vuse won’t turn on, here are a few reasons why:

No Power Supply

Sometimes, the issue might arise from simply not pressing the button long enough. Ensure you are following the correct power-on procedure as per the manufacturer’s guidelines.

Defective Device

If the device is brand new and still not working, there might be a manufacturing defect. In such cases, reach out to customer service or the place of purchase for assistance.

4. Sensor Issues

Vuse devices rely on various sensors to operate correctly.

Dirty or Blocked Sensors

Dirt and grime can obstruct the sensors that detect inhalation. Keeping your device clean can prevent sensor issues. A gentle wipe with a cotton swab can remove excess debris.

Malfunctioning Sensor

If cleaning doesn’t work, the sensor might be malfunctioning. This issue is less common but may require professional repair or replacement.

5. Software Glitches

Modern Vuse devices often come equipped with software to enhance performance. However, just like any electronic device, software glitches can occur.

Software Update Needed

Occasionally, your device may require an update to function smoothly. Check the manufacturer’s website for software-related updates specific to your model.

Factory Reset

If you suspect that software issues are causing your device to fail, sometimes performing a factory reset can help restore normal function. Ensure you consult your user manual for the steps to accomplish this.

Why is my Vuse not producing any vapor?

If your Vuse is not producing vapor, it could be due to several reasons. First, check the battery; ensure that it is fully charged. A drained battery can prevent the device from heating properly, resulting in a lack of vapor. Additionally, inspect the connection points between the pod and the battery. Dust or debris in these areas may hinder proper connectivity, causing performance issues.

Another potential cause could be a faulty or empty pod. If the pod is new, ensure it’s inserted correctly. If it’s an older pod, it may be depleted. You can try replacing the pod with a new one to see if that resolves the issue. Also, check for any signs of leakage, which can indicate that the pod is damaged and needs to be replaced.

Why does my Vuse taste burnt?

A burnt taste when using your Vuse often indicates that the coil of the pod is burnt out. This can happen if the device is used after the e-liquid has run low, causing the coil to burn dry. Always ensure that there’s enough e-liquid in the pod to prevent this. If you notice a burnt taste, it’s advisable to stop using the pod immediately and replace it with a new one.

Another possibility could be the wattage settings if your device allows for adjustments. Setting the wattage too high for the type of pod you are using can lead to overheating and burning the material. Always adhere to the manufacturer’s recommendations for wattage settings to prolong the life of the pod and prevent this unpleasant taste.

What should I do if my Vuse is leaking?

If your Vuse is leaking, the first step is to check the pod for any signs of damage or cracks. A compromised pod can cause leaking issues, so replacing it with a new one is usually the best course of action. Make sure that the pod is properly sealed and securely attached to the battery. Any gaps can also lead to leakage, so ensuring a snug fit is crucial.

Additionally, be mindful of how you store your device. Storing it in a position where it can be jostled or on an uneven surface may increase the likelihood of leaks. If leaking persists after replacing the pod and checking for damage, it may be worthwhile to contact customer support for further assistance.

Why is my Vuse blinking?

A blinking light on your Vuse typically indicates that there’s an issue with the device, such as a low battery or a problem with the pod connection. First, verify that the battery is charged. If the light blinks when you attempt to take a puff, it likely means the battery is depleted and will need to be recharged before using the device again.

If the battery is charged and the light continues to blink, the problem may lie within the pod. Remove and reseat the pod to ensure a good connection. Sometimes, simply reinserting the pod can resolve connection issues. If the problem persists after checking both the battery and the pod, it might be time to consider reaching out to customer support for additional troubleshooting or potential repairs.

Why is my Vuse not hitting properly?

If your Vuse is not hitting properly, it could be related to airflow or a blockage within the pod. Inspect the mouthpiece for any obstructions, and consider cleaning it if necessary. Make sure that the pod is fully inserted into the battery and that there’s no debris interfering with airflow. Regular maintenance and cleaning can enhance the device’s overall performance.

Additionally, check your inhaling technique. Sometimes, a gentle, steady draw may be more effective than a quick pull. Too aggressive of a draw can overwhelm the coil and impede vapor flow. If you’ve checked these issues and are still experiencing problems, consider replacing the pod, as it may be reaching the end of its lifespan.

What does it mean if my Vuse is showing a temperature warning?

A temperature warning on your Vuse indicates that the device is overheating and needs to cool down. This can happen if the device is used continuously for an extended period. It’s important to take a break and allow the device to cool off. Using it excessively can lead to malfunction and may damage the internal components.

To prevent receiving a temperature warning, try adhering to recommended usage guidelines. Avoid chain vaping and allow time between puffs for the device to properly cool. If the warning persists even after allowing the device to cool, there may be an issue with the battery or internal electronics, which might necessitate contacting customer support for further evaluation.

How can I tell if my Vuse pod is empty?

Determining if your Vuse pod is empty can be done in several ways. Most pods have a transparent window, allowing you to visually check the liquid level. If the e-liquid is at or near the bottom of the pod, it’s time to replace it. Additionally, you might notice a change in flavor or a burnt taste, which are clear indicators that the pod is running low or empty.

If you’re unsure about the e-liquid level, you can also shake the pod gently. If you notice little to no e-liquid moving inside, it likely means the pod is empty. For future reference, always keep an eye on your e-liquid levels to avoid using the pod until it’s completely depleted, as this can lead to coil burnout and diminished flavor.

What can I do if my Vuse battery won’t charge?

If your Vuse battery won’t charge, start by checking the charging equipment you’re using. Ensure that both the USB cable and the adapter are functioning correctly. Sometimes, using a different charger or USB port can resolve the issue. Additionally, inspect the battery’s charging port for any debris that might prevent a good connection.

If the battery still won’t charge after trying different cables or power sources, it may be indicative of a deeper problem with the battery itself. In that case, consider replacing the battery or contacting customer support for further assistance. It’s essential to address battery issues promptly to avoid compromising your vaping experience.
